Femtosecond stimulated Raman spectrometer in the 320-520nm range

Opt Express. 2011 Jan 17;19(2):1107-12. doi: 10.1364/OE.19.001107.

Abstract

Multi-µJ narrow-bandwidth (≈ 10 cm(-1)) picosecond pulses, broadly tunable in the visible-UV range (320-520 nm), are generated by spectral compression of femtosecond pulses emitted by an amplified Ti:sapphire system. Such pulses provide the ideal Raman pump for broadband femtosecond stimulated Raman spectroscopy, as here demonstrated on a heme protein.
